    • Modern JavaScript emphasizes simplicity, readability, and predictability. Instead of memorizing new syntax, learn through practical examples that demonstrate how these changes enhance code expressiveness. Begin with variable declarations that clearly convey intention, and explore how modern principles can elevate all aspects of coding. Incorporate techniques such as curried functions, array methods, and classes to create efficient code that minimizes bugs. This approach promotes writing clean and expressive JavaScript, making it simpler and more predictable than ever. Discover how to improve your coding practices with clear examples that illustrate how updated syntax can lead to better, more reliable code. Starting from foundational concepts, learn to apply new syntax or repurpose older styles to transform clunky scripts into elegant programs that are easy to read and extend. Establish a solid basis for readable code by using simple variable declarations that limit side effects and subtle bugs. Choose collections with clear objectives rather than relying solely on objects or arrays, and simplify iterations from complex loops to concise array methods. Master techniques for crafting flexible and robust code, including higher-order functions, reusable classes, and architectural patterns for large applications that can withstand refactoring and evolving requirements.       "Joe Morgan again shows himself a rare an ex-jock with savvy and the ability to communicate it."— People "This book has something for everybody, from longtime fans to Little Leaguers."— New York Newsday Baseball For Dummies, Third Edition, is for baseball fans at all levels, from players and coaches to spectators who love the game. Baseball Hall of Fame player and ESPN baseball analyst Joe Morgan explains baseball with remarkable insight, using down-to-earth language so everyone from the casual observer to the die-hard fan can gain a fuller appreciation of the sport. This updated edition From how to throw a knuckleball or hit an inside pitch to how to keep a scorecard or pick a winning fantasy league team, Morgan covers all the bases, showing you how to get the most out of the game. You’ll see how Complete with Morgan’s personal lists of top-ten pitchers, fielders, and relievers, as well as new quotes from Derek Jeter and Keith Hernandez, Baseball For Dummies gives you all the inside tips, facts, and stats so you can play like a Major Leaguer!
